Nestled in the heart of North Texas, Denton is a vibrant city known for its rich cultural heritage and lively music scene. With a population that embraces creativity and artistic expression, Denton has become a hub for musicians, artists, and performers alike. The city is home to several universities, including the University of North Texas and Texas Woman’s University, both of which contribute to its dynamic atmosphere.
As you stroll through the historic downtown area, you’ll find an eclectic mix of live music venues, art galleries, and local shops that reflect the community’s passion for the arts. Denton’s commitment to music is evident in its numerous festivals and events that celebrate various genres, from jazz to folk. The annual Denton Arts and Jazz Festival draws thousands of visitors each year, showcasing local talent and fostering a sense of community.

What to Look for in a Music School and Voice Lesson Program
When searching for a music school or voice lesson program, it’s essential to consider several key factors that will influence your learning experience. First and foremost, you should evaluate the curriculum offered by the school. A well-rounded program should provide a comprehensive approach to music education, covering essential topics such as music theory, ear training, and performance techniques.
Look for schools that offer a variety of classes tailored to different skill levels, ensuring that you can progress at your own pace. Another critical aspect to consider is the qualifications and experience of the instructors. You want to learn from passionate educators who have a strong background in music and teaching.
Research their credentials, performance experience, and teaching philosophy to ensure they align with your goals. Additionally, consider the student-to-teacher ratio; smaller class sizes often lead to more personalized attention and a better learning environment. Finally, take note of the school’s facilities and resources, such as practice rooms, instruments, and technology that can enhance your learning experience.

The Importance of Vocal Training
Vocal training is an essential component of any musician’s education, regardless of their chosen genre or instrument. Developing your voice not only enhances your singing ability but also improves your overall musicianship. Through vocal training, you learn proper techniques for breath control, pitch accuracy, and vocal health, which are crucial for any aspiring singer.
Moreover, understanding how to use your voice effectively can help you convey emotion and connect with your audience on a deeper level. Choosing the Right Voice Lesson Instructor
Selecting the right voice lesson instructor is crucial for your success as a singer. A good instructor should not only possess strong credentials but also have a teaching style that resonates with you. Take the time to meet potential instructors and discuss your goals; this will help you gauge their approach and determine if it aligns with your aspirations.
Look for someone who encourages open communication and creates a supportive environment where you feel comfortable exploring your voice. Additionally, consider the instructor’s experience with different musical styles. If you have a specific genre in mind—be it classical, pop, or jazz—finding an instructor who specializes in that area can be beneficial.
They will be better equipped to provide tailored guidance and help you develop your unique sound. Remember that building a rapport with your instructor is essential; a positive relationship can significantly enhance your learning experience and motivate you to reach your full potential.
Benefits of Music Education for Children and Adults
Music education offers numerous benefits for individuals of all ages. For children, engaging in music lessons can enhance cognitive development, improve academic performance, and foster social skills. Studies have shown that children who participate in music programs often excel in subjects like math and reading due to the discipline and focus required for learning an instrument or singing.
Furthermore, music education encourages teamwork and collaboration when participating in ensembles or group classes.
